Prices Athlete: 20€ (meal excluded) TIP meal tray: €10 per day Register Rules Savate French boxing 2 non-gendered competitions (touch sparing): Team competition (beginner and intermediate levels): open to people with a maximum of 1 to 3 years of practice. Each person will compete in their category against the other teams. Teams will be formed by the organization. Individual competition (advanced level): open to those with a red glove (or equivalent) and a minimum of 3 years of practice. Those with a green glove and more than three years of practice may be assigned to the individual competition in the interests of sporting fairness. Both competitions are gender-neutral and categories will be based on the level, weight, and height of the participants. Weight categories will be respected as much as possible to ensure fairness and safety in this competition. The definition of these categories will depend on the size of the registered participants. In all cases, the rules of combat as defined by the French Federation of Savate Boxe Française and Associated Disciplines (FFSBF) will apply, with particular attention paid to technique, control of the power of blows and their trajectories (kicks must be armed). This is not a fight: attempting to knock out an opponent (KO) is therefore prohibited and will be penalized. English boxing An individual educational boxing competition will be organized. Beginner, intermediate, and advanced levels are accepted (these will be strictly respected in the composition of the pools). Advanced competitors may be assigned—subject to their agreement—to “amateur boxing” pools. Three gender categories will be offered as far as possible: women, men, and non-binary. Each category will be divided into subcategories according to the weight, height, and level of the participants. Competitors must prevail through their technical and tactical skills, but under no circumstances through the power of their blows. The speed of execution is not modified in any way, but must be accompanied by total control of the impact, otherwise penalties will be imposed. Attempting to knock out (KO) an opponent is prohibited. Detailed information Fruit Apple or Banana Partner Spotlight: Ideel Garden We have chosen to partner with Ideel Garden, a caterer that transforms the lunch break into a positive act for the planet. Here is why we believe in their approach: 100% Organic & Seasonal: All fruits and vegetables used are certified organic. Menus follow the natural rhythm of the seasons to guarantee maximum freshness and flavor. Reduced Carbon Footprint: Their meals emit up to 3 times less CO2 than a traditional cafeteria meal. Notably, they have removed beef from their recipes, as it is the leading source of carbon emissions in the food industry. Zero-Waste Goal: No more plastic! Ideel Garden uses a system of glass jars that are collected, washed, and reused indefinitely, eliminating single-use packaging. Healthy & Local Cuisine: All dishes are "homemade" in their kitchens in Montreuil, without additives or preservatives. 80% of their recipes are rated Nutriscore A. Sustainable Agriculture: They support agro-ecology models that protect the soil and promote biodiversity. By choosing this service, you are doing more than just fueling your body: you are supporting a circular, virtuous, and local economy. Anyone else wishing to join the tournament will need to notify to petitesfrappes@gmail.com to be placed on waiting list by filling in the following form : >> Waiting List Form This competition will be mixed and organized by skill level: - level A : advanced level - level B : strong intermediate level - level C : intermediate level - level D : beginner level When registering, each athlete may indicate whether to accept over-classification or sub-classification. The first qualifying match will be best of two sets, straight to 11 points. All subsequent matches will be best of three sets, with a two-point margin required to win a set. All matches are won in 2 sets with a difference of 2 points, except finals which will be in three winning sets (except in case of time problem). Each player can expect to play 4–5 matches over the course of the day. This may be adjusted if necessary. Rankings and medal presentations will be conducted by level. An additional ranking and a separate medal presentation will be held for women, across all levels. More about our private partners The artistic Space - Exhibition ¡Qué Escándalo! - Arcades Salon Art for inclusion Headlining the 19th Paris International Tournament at City Hall. For just one day, the art exhibition! From May 22 to 24, 2026, the 19th edition of the Paris International Tournament transforms Paris into a living arena of solidarity, competition, and visibility. Founded by the LGBT+ Sports Federation, the tournament brings together thousands of athletes from around the world to defend a simple but radical idea: every body deserves space, dignity, and freedom in public life and sports. At the symbolic heart of this year's edition – inside the historic halls of the Paris City Hall – the international collective ¡Qué Escándalo! presents a main exhibition exploring the body both as a battlefield and a territory of liberation. Organized by Nikita Egorov-Kirillov and Torro Osten , the exhibition connects queer identity, migration, and contemporary sport through works created by artists from Europe, Latin America, the Middle East, and Asia. What emerges is not a single narrative, but a polyphony of survival stories shaped by exile, transformation, vulnerability, and endurance. Sport has long been associated with discipline, masculinity, hierarchy, and national identity. Yet, for queer and migrant communities, the athletic body has often existed under scrutiny—judged, excluded, fetishized, or politicized. In this context, the exhibition asks the question: what does it mean for marginalized bodies not only to survive visibility but to occupy space in a competitive, collective, and proud way? For many participating artists, the body is not an abstraction. He carries boundaries, memories, work, transitions, wounds, pleasure, and fear. Like athletes entering a tournament, queer migrants are constantly negotiating with systems of control: language barriers, bureaucracy, economic precarity, social hostility, and the psychological pressure of reinvention. The exhibition presents these experiences not as peripheral stories, but as acts of endurance and resistance. Founded in Madrid by refugee and migrant LGBTQ+ artists , ¡Qué Escándalo! began as a small self-organized exhibition among displaced creatives seeking to rebuild their lives through art. What united them was not nationality or style, but the urgent need to remain visible within societies that often demand assimilation or silence. Two years later, the collective transformed into a growing international platform with exhibitions across Spain and Europe, bringing together emerging and established voices through radically different artistic languages The exhibition reflects this multiplicity: Italian abstractionism exists alongside Russian art brut, contemporary Chinese botanical painting alongside Iranian pop art, Venezuelan photojournalism alongside French ultra-realism and Spanish portrait photography. The diversity of aesthetics mirrors the very diversity of queer existence. There is no single queer image, no single migrant narrative, no single political voice. Instead, ¡Qué Escándalo! embraces contradiction, emotional intensity, fragmentation, celebration, and noise—taking up what dominant culture often rejects as 'too much,' 'too emotional,' or indeed, 'escándalo.' Presented as part of one of Europe's largest inclusive sporting events, the exhibition also recontextualizes the competition itself. Beyond medals and rankings, sport becomes a metaphor for persistence: the trained body, the exhausted body, the disciplined body, the body refusing to disappear. Every athlete arriving at the TIP carries a personal story of overcoming shame, exclusion, or invisibility. The same goes for the artists gathered in this exhibition. At a time when the rights of queer people, the lives of migrants, and bodily autonomy are increasingly contested around the world, Art for Inclusion offers another vision of community - a vision based not on similarity, but on coexistence. Here, art and sport meet not through spectacle, but through a shared politics of presence. To compete is to declare: I am here. To exhibit is to declare the same thing. ¡Qué Escándalo ! Accomodation Discover how to make the most of your Parisian nights The Paris International Tournament welcomes athletes from all over France, Europe and beyond. Because of budget restraints or simply to meet new people, you may want to be hosted by local participants close to your sport location(s) or to the TIP events. Each year, it is an opportunity to create delightful memories and a unique way to discover Paris while creating friendships with the other athletes. The accommodation is free from Friday to Monday. The TIP puts those who would like to be hosted in contact with people offering a hosting solution via a new platform for an efficient pairing. You'll be able to post an accommodation offer or go through the list of available housing solutions from your registration page . We are counting on you to continue this tradition and allow more athletes to come and take part in the Paris International Tournament 🔍 I am looking for an accommodation Do you live abroad or far from Paris region? A volunteer can accommodate you for the duration of the tournament. To do so, simply chose "I would like to stay with a local TIP participant" from the accommodation section when registering. You will get a link to all available accommodation offers so you can browse the perfect match. Simply contact the person who published the hosting solution to validate availability and confirm your venue details. If you don't find an accomadation right away, don't worry! As more athletes register, more offers will become available. Keep looking at the offer page from your registration page. If you have already registered or if you changed your mind, you can make the changes directly on the registration page later on. Access registration page 🏠 I c an accommodate Do you live in Paris or close to public transport for easy access to sports facilities? You can host one or more people in your home and help an athlete visiting Paris by offering a place to stay during the tournament! To do so, simply complete the dedicated hosting section when registering and select "I can host TIP participant(s)". Then complete the details about your your accommodation and it will appear on a page listing all the offers. A link to a page with all the accommodation offers will be sent to people who wish to be hosted and they will be invited to contact you to validate availability and affinity. If your place is attributed or if you changed your mind, you can make the changes directly on the registration page later on. Access registration page Accommodation commitments To ensure that everything goes well for the host as well as for the traveling athlete, we will ask everyone to respect the following commitments: When contacting a host, please be courteous and benevolent, Respect the rules of hospitality, Respect the rules and constraints of life, Respect the furnitures, The hosts shouldn’t provide meals (lunch, dinner) but they should provide basic breakfast items (beverages, fruits) and help by providing nearby restaurant locations, No remuneration may be requested Accommodation must be provided during the tournament period. If requested the host may accommodate the traveling athlete longer to his/her own discretion.
